Monarda punctata
Explore definitions, synonyms, and language insights of Monarda punctata
Definitions
Noun
tall erect perennial or annual having lanceolate leaves and heads of purple-spotted creamy flowers; many subspecies grown from eastern to southwestern United States and in Mexico